今天给各位分享c语言数组计算结果的知识,其中也会对c语言数组计算结果怎么写进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
C语言数组输出结果问题
array[j]!=\0是一个不确定条件,因为数组中没有这个值,所以j会一直加,直到遇到空,然而哪里有空,谁也不知道。
即可。/* 对一维顺序数组进行螺旋输出(不是顺序的话就先进行排序)主要思想:对用拥有X*Y个元素的数组分为Y行输出,每行X个数。
第一在你没有加a[i]=i之前,由于没有给数组赋值,所以里面的值是随机的。
C语言,一维字符数组用%s输出必须要有字符串的串尾符才不会出错。不是必须定义长度ch[5]才可以的。
因为else if(num99999 && num0)的()中的num99999 && num0是永远不可能为“真”的表达式,所以无论输入什么数据都不会执行。根据疑问1的表述,这一句应该写成else if(num99999 || num0)可能才对。
for语句再使用过程中,把内容用括号括起来,不论你是不是只有一条执行语句。
c语言求数组的和及平均值
1、思路:定义float类型数组,接着依次输入个数,并累加求和,最后输出累加和除以10的值。
2、由于只是要计算最终的平均值,所以可以不从数组移除,而是累加10个数的和值,再减去两个最值;输入时可以不保存数组,而是输入一个处理一个,降低空间开销;输入时可以同时执行累加及查找最值操作。
3、首先我们新建一个dev C++的项目。接下来在项目中新建C语言程序文件。然后在C语言文件中声明一个字节数组。接下来我们通过printf函数提示用户输入字符串,通过scanf接收用户输入的字符串。
4、然后在循环语句外使用(***erage=sum/10)来计算10个数的平均数。按照题目的要求完源代码之后,点击“运行”,弹出输入页面之后,在输出页面输入10个整数值,然后点击回车键,计算机即可计算出10个数的平均数了。
5、定义a、b、c来表示我们所要输入的三位不同的整数,temp表示求出最小值时的中间变值,***erage表示我们所求的平均值,***allest表示我们最终要求出的最小值,分别定义给其分配空间。
6、参数说明: a是一维浮点数数组,n是数组中的元素个数 下面的函数求a中元素的平均值,并返回。
C语言题目
下面是一个可以利用指针将两个字符串连接起来的 C 语言程序。该程序定义了一个子函数 `StrCat`,用于将两个字符串连接起来,并返回连接后的结果。
第4题 题目类型: 单选题 题目:以下( 语言定义严格 )不是C语言的特点。第5题 题目类型: 单选题 题目:下面个选项组中,均属于C语言关键字的一组是(,typedef,continue )。
[回答]1. 用C语言自己的时间函数 difftime(time_t time1, time_t time0) / 86400 这样做得缺点是,这里的time_t类型,只支持到2037年 2. 自己定义函数 楼主用的方法,在实际编程里不常用,变化比较大。
a[1][4]={5,6,7,8} a[2][4]={9,10,11,12} a[3][4]={13,14,15,16} for进行了四次循环,每次循环加上二维数组的第2列的数。
x是float*类型(指向float类型的指针)。C.y=x[2]+1; [_a***_],y是float类型,x[2]也是float类型。D.x[0]=y; 正确,x[0]是float类型,y也是float类型。
用C语言实现:输入一个3*4的int型数组,计算数组元素的总和,每行元素的平...
includeiostream //若为0编译器,改为#includeiostream.h using namespace std; //0,将此句删除。
关于c语言数组计算结果和c语言数组计算结果怎么写的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。